显示数据库的命令是什么

worktile 其他 1

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要显示数据库的命令取决于所使用的数据库管理系统。以下是几个常用的数据库管理系统及其相应的命令:

    1. MySQL:使用MySQL数据库管理系统,可以使用以下命令来显示数据库:

      • SHOW DATABASES;:显示所有数据库的列表。
      • SHOW SCHEMAS;:与上述命令相同,显示所有数据库的列表。
      • SHOW CREATE DATABASE database_name;:显示指定数据库的创建语句。
    2. Oracle:对于Oracle数据库管理系统,可以使用以下命令来显示数据库:

      • SELECT name FROM v$database;:显示当前连接的数据库的名称。
      • SELECT DISTINCT owner FROM all_tables;:显示所有表的所有者(即数据库)。
      • SELECT tablespace_name FROM dba_tablespaces;:显示所有表空间的名称。
    3. SQL Server:对于SQL Server数据库管理系统,可以使用以下命令来显示数据库:

      • SELECT name FROM sys.databases;:显示所有数据库的名称。
      • EXEC sp_helpdb;:显示数据库的详细信息,包括大小、状态等。
      • EXEC sp_databases;:显示所有数据库的名称和所有者。
    4. PostgreSQL:对于PostgreSQL数据库管理系统,可以使用以下命令来显示数据库:

      • \l:显示所有数据库的列表。
      • \c database_name:连接到指定的数据库并显示相关信息。
      • \dt:显示当前数据库中所有表的列表。
    5. MongoDB:对于MongoDB数据库管理系统,可以使用以下命令来显示数据库:

      • show dbs;:显示所有数据库的列表。
      • use database_name;:切换到指定的数据库。
      • show collections;:显示当前数据库中所有集合(类似于表)的列表。

    注意:不同的数据库管理系统可能有不同的命令和语法。请根据所使用的具体数据库管理系统的文档来查找相应的命令。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    显示数据库的命令可以根据不同的数据库管理系统而有所不同。以下是几种常见的数据库管理系统及其对应的命令:

    1. MySQL:

      • 显示所有数据库:SHOW DATABASES;
      • 显示当前选中的数据库:SELECT DATABASE();
      • 显示数据库中的所有表:SHOW TABLES;
      • 显示表的结构:DESCRIBE table_name;
    2. Oracle:

      • 显示所有数据库:SELECT name FROM v$database;
      • 显示当前选中的数据库:SELECT name FROM v$database;
      • 显示数据库中的所有表:SELECT table_name FROM all_tables;
      • 显示表的结构:DESCRIBE table_name;
    3. SQL Server:

      • 显示所有数据库:SELECT name FROM sys.databases;
      • 显示当前选中的数据库:SELECT DB_NAME();
      • 显示数据库中的所有表:SELECT name FROM sys.tables;
      • 显示表的结构:EXEC sp_columns table_name;
    4. PostgreSQL:

      • 显示所有数据库:SELECT datname FROM pg_database;
      • 显示当前选中的数据库:SELECT current_database();
      • 显示数据库中的所有表:SELECT table_name FROM information_schema.tables WHERE table_schema = 'public';
      • 显示表的结构:SELECT column_name, data_type FROM information_schema.columns WHERE table_name = 'table_name';

    请注意,以上命令仅作为示例,具体的命令可能会有所不同,具体要根据使用的数据库管理系统版本和配置进行调整。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    显示数据库的命令是SHOW DATABASES。这个命令用于显示当前数据库服务器上的所有数据库。在不同的数据库管理系统中,这个命令的语法和使用方式可能会有所不同。

    在MySQL中,可以使用以下方法来显示数据库:

    1. 使用命令行工具:打开命令行终端,并登录到MySQL数据库服务器。然后输入以下命令:
    SHOW DATABASES;
    

    这将显示服务器上所有的数据库列表。

    1. 使用图形化工具:如果你使用的是MySQL的图形化工具,如phpMyAdmin,Navicat等,你可以通过选择相应的菜单或者按钮来显示数据库列表。

    在SQL Server中,可以使用以下方法来显示数据库:

    1. 使用SQL Server Management Studio:打开SQL Server Management Studio,连接到SQL Server数据库服务器。然后在"对象资源管理器"窗口中展开服务器节点,展开"数据库"节点,即可看到所有的数据库。

    2. 使用Transact-SQL:打开SQL Server Management Studio,连接到SQL Server数据库服务器。然后在"查询"窗口中输入以下命令:

    SELECT name FROM sys.databases;
    

    执行该命令后,将会返回服务器上所有数据库的名称。

    在Oracle数据库中,可以使用以下方法来显示数据库:

    1. 使用SQL*Plus:打开命令行终端,并登录到Oracle数据库服务器。然后输入以下命令:
    SELECT name FROM v$database;
    

    这将显示当前数据库的名称。

    1. 使用Oracle Enterprise Manager:如果你使用的是Oracle Enterprise Manager,你可以通过选择相应的菜单或者按钮来显示数据库列表。

    无论你使用哪种数据库管理系统,显示数据库的命令都是用来查看服务器上所有数据库的。这对于管理和维护数据库非常有用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部